Laminate Underlayment Guide: What It Actually Does (and What It Doesn’t)

Choosing laminate flooring is only half the decision. What goes under your laminate matters just as much—especially in North Carolina’s fluctuating climate.

This guide explains how laminate underlayment actually works, where it helps, and where expectations need to be realistic.

What Laminate Underlayment Actually Does

1. Moisture Control (Not Waterproofing)

Underlayment with a moisture barrier helps block vapor coming up from concrete slabs or crawlspaces. This is especially important in:

  • Greensboro slab foundations
  • Coastal Wilmington homes with high ground moisture

However, underlayment does not stop:

  • Plumbing leaks
  • Standing water
  • Flooding

Moisture barriers slow vapor transmission—they don’t make laminate waterproof.

2. Sound Reduction (Within Limits)

Underlayment reduces:

  • Footfall noise
  • Hollow “click-clack” sounds
  • Sound transfer to rooms below

Sound ratings like IIC and STC matter most in multi-level homes or condos. Thicker isn’t always quieter—density and material matter more.

3. Minor Subfloor Smoothing

Underlayment can help absorb tiny imperfections, but it does not fix:

  • Uneven subfloors
  • Low spots
  • Structural dips

Trying to “pad out” a bad subfloor leads to joint failure and voided warranties.

What Underlayment Does NOT Do

  • It does not replace subfloor prep
  • It does not correct moisture problems
  • It does not make laminate feel like hardwood
  • It does not compensate for poor installation

Types of Laminate Underlayment Explained

Foam Underlayment

  • Most common
  • Affordable
  • Light sound reduction
    Best for: plywood subfloors in low-moisture areas

Cork Underlayment

  • Denser and quieter
  • Naturally mold-resistant
  • Higher cost
    Best for: multi-story homes and noise-sensitive spaces

Combination Underlayment (Foam + Vapor Barrier)

  • Built-in moisture protection
  • Cleaner installation
    Best for: slabs, crawlspaces, coastal environments

Thickness: How Much Is Too Much?

Most laminate manufacturers recommend 2–3mm underlayment. Thicker options can cause:

  • Locking system stress
  • Excess movement
  • Premature joint failure

Always follow the flooring manufacturer’s specifications to protect warranties.

Underlayment and Warranties

Using the wrong underlayment—or stacking layers—can void:

  • Structural warranties
  • Wear layer coverage
  • Moisture protection claims

Laminate underlayment is a performance layer—not a problem solver. When chosen correctly, it improves comfort, protects against moisture, and extends floor life. When chosen incorrectly, it creates issues you won’t see until months later.
